RF13 FLE is a 2013 Peugeot 107 in Purple with a 998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.9%.

Across all 2013 Peugeot 107 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.3% with a typical mileage of 40,622 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Peugeot 107 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 42,280 recorded failures. If you're considering buying RF13 FLE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Peugeot 107 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 13 years old, this Peugeot 107 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
